Roof waterproofing services involve applying protective coatings or membranes to prevent water from penetrating the roof surface. These services are suitable for a variety of projects, including flat roofs, sloped roofs, and commercial or residential structures. Property owners typically seek waterproofing to safeguard their buildings against leaks, water damage, and the deterioration of roofing materials,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or seasonal changes.

Before requesting roof waterproofing, homeowners often want to understand the condition of their existing roof, the types of waterproofing products available, and the expected lifespan of the treatment. It’s also common to inquire about the preparation process, such as repairs needed prior to waterproofing, and whether the service is suitable for their specific roof type. Proper assessment ensures the most effective protection and helps property owners make informed decisions about maintaining their roofs.

Common Roof Waterproofing Jobs

Flat roof waterproofing - helps prevent leaks and water damage on low-sloped roofs.

Shingle roof sealing - protects the roofing material from moisture infiltration.

Commercial roof waterproofing - ensures business properties stay dry and protected.

Roof coating application - extends the lifespan of existing roofing systems.

Leak repair and sealing - addresses vulnerabilities to keep interiors dry.

Deck and balcony waterproofing - safeguards outdoor living spaces from water intrusion.

Roof Waterproofing Questions

What is roof waterproofing? Roof waterproofing involves applying materials to prevent water penetration and protect the roof structure from leaks and damage.

What types of roofs benefit from waterproofing? Flat and low-slope roofs are common projects for waterproofing, especially to prevent water pooling and leaks.

How does waterproofing protect a roof? It creates a barrier that stops water from seeping into the roofing materials and underlying structures.

What signs indicate a roof needs waterproofing? Signs include persistent leaks, water stains on ceilings, or visible cracks in roofing materials.
